Back Where It All Began: Voice Study Centre Student Catherine Ogden’s Full Circle Moment at UCLan

Tuesday 3rd June 2025

We'd like to congratulate our MA student, Catherine Ogden, on her new role as Associate Lecturer in Music Theatre at the University of Central Lancashire (UCLan)!

Catherine reflected on this full-circle moment, sharing:

"As a proud UCLan Music Theatre graduate, I never imagined I’d one day return - not as a student, but as a lecturer.

During my undergraduate years, I discovered a deep passion for vocal pedagogy, inspired by outstanding mentors and opportunities like singing in the UCLan Chamber Choir (which needs a whole post of its own!). That journey eventually led me to postgraduate study and a deep dive into voice science and education. I’ve also spent a long time studying the benefits of singing for our wellbeing, and how to look after our voices. Teaching the voice brings me so much joy. It’s rarely ever felt like work because it is an utter privilege to help people understand/learn about their instrument!

I’m thrilled to share that I’ve been appointed as Lecturer in Music Theatre at UCLan, specialising in singing and leading the choir that once meant so much to me. It is a privilege to step into a role that shaped my own path, and I’m so grateful to be back - this time, helping others find their voices.

A true full circle moment and one I don’t take lightly! I cannot wait for this new chapter!"
What a beautiful journey!
